+ Podman rootless
+
+ You can use this when Nextcloud is installed in Docker(for example), and the DSP will run on the host network on Podman.
+
+ ```bash
+ podman run -e NC_HAPROXY_PASSWORD="some_secure_password" \
+ -e BIND_ADDRESS="172.17.0.1" \
+ -v /run/user/1000/podman/podman.sock:/var/run/docker.sock \
+ -v `pwd`/certs/cert.pem:/certs/cert.pem \
+ --name nextcloud-appapi-dsp -h nextcloud-appapi-dsp --net host \
+ --privileged -d nextcloud-appapi-dsp:latest
+ ```
